1. 2026 Kyrgyzstan Unmarried Surrogacy Cost Breakdown
Cost is one of the core concerns for unmarried individuals. In 2026, completing a full unmarried surrogacy process in Kyrgyzstan typically costs between 300,000 and 550,000 RMB, varying based on personal health conditions, chosen agency, and service package. Below is a detailed breakdown of each cost component:
- Medical-related costs: Including ovulation induction medications, egg retrieval surgery, embryo culture, genetic screening, and embryo transfer, approximately 90,000 to 130,000 RMB. This part varies depending on the medication protocol and embryo testing items.
- Surrogate compensation and management fees: Surrogate's compensation, pregnancy nutrition allowance, prenatal check-up costs, and living management, approximately 110,000 to 160,000 RMB. Legitimate agencies will purchase pregnancy insurance for the surrogate, which is included in this cost.
- Legal and notarization service fees: Including drafting surrogacy agreements, legal consultation, notarization, and authentication, approximately 30,000 to 50,000 RMB. Unmarried individuals need to pay special attention to the completeness of legal documents to ensure the legal rights of the baby after birth.
- Agency and service management fees: Covering translation, local accompaniment, accommodation coordination, pregnancy follow-up management, etc., approximately 50,000 to 80,000 RMB. Choosing an all-inclusive service agency usually offers more transparent costs.
- Other miscellaneous costs: Such as round-trip transportation, accommodation and meals during the stay in Kyrgyzstan, and document processing after the baby's birth, approximately 40,000 to 80,000 RMB. This part has high flexibility, and it is recommended to set aside sufficient contingency funds.
Overall, the cost of unmarried surrogacy in Kyrgyzstan in 2026 is about 20% to 30% lower than in traditional surrogacy countries like Russia and Ukraine, and the process is more straightforward, attracting many clients from China and other Asian regions.
2. Conditions Required for Unmarried Individuals to Pursue Surrogacy in Kyrgyzstan in 2026
Kyrgyzstan law sets a clear framework of conditions for unmarried individuals pursuing surrogacy. The policy in 2026 remains stable, mainly including the following aspects:
- Age requirement: Applicants must be between 22 and 48 years old. Those over 45 need to provide an additional health assessment report.
- Health conditions: No serious genetic diseases, no infectious diseases. Female applicants need to pass an ovarian function assessment, and males need to provide a semen analysis report. All tests must be completed at a medical institution recognized by Kyrgyzstan.
- Identity and legal documents: Provide a valid passport, certificate of unmarried status, or notarized single status declaration. Kyrgyzstan recognizes notarized single status certificates after translation, without the need for complex marital status changes.
- Psychological evaluation: Applicants must pass a mental health assessment to prove they have the psychological readiness and sense of responsibility to raise a child. This is an important step to protect the child's rights.
- Proof of financial capacity: Provide bank statements or asset certificates to ensure sufficient funds to cover the entire surrogacy process and at least one year of child-rearing expenses after birth.
- Signing the surrogacy agreement: Sign the surrogacy agreement in the presence of a Kyrgyzstan lawyer, clarifying the rights and obligations of all parties. The agreement must be notarized by a notary office and has legal effect.
The above conditions are the basic threshold for unmarried surrogacy in Kyrgyzstan in 2026. Different agencies may add individual supplementary requirements based on their own processes, but the overall framework remains consistent.
3. Step-by-Step Guide to the 2026 Kyrgyzstan Unmarried Surrogacy Process
From initial consultation to the baby's birth, the complete cycle for unmarried surrogacy in Kyrgyzstan in 2026 typically takes 14 to 20 months. The specific steps are as follows:
- Step 1: Preliminary consultation and evaluation. Learn about Kyrgyzstan's legal policies, cost structure, and process arrangements through a professional agency, while undergoing preliminary physical examinations and fertility assessments to determine suitability for entering the surrogacy program.
- Step 2: Legal preparation and agreement signing. Hire a local Kyrgyzstan lawyer to draft the surrogacy agreement, complete notarization and translation certification. Unmarried individuals should pay special attention to clauses regarding parentage in the legal documents.
- Step 3: Initiation of medical procedures. Including ovulation induction, egg and sperm retrieval, embryo culture, and genetic screening. Embryo culture typically lasts 5 to 6 days, forming blastocysts before pre-implantation testing.
- Step 4: Matching with a surrogate and embryo transfer. The agency matches a healthy surrogate, who undergoes physical and psychological evaluations before embryo transfer. Pregnancy can be confirmed approximately 10 to 12 days after transfer.
- Step 5: Pregnancy monitoring and management. After the surrogate becomes pregnant, the agency arranges regular prenatal check-ups and nutritional guidance, while updating the applicant on pregnancy progress. Applicants may choose to travel to Kyrgyzstan to accompany before the baby's birth.
- Step 6: Baby's birth and document processing. After the child is born, complete birth registration in Kyrgyzstan, followed by parentage determination, passport application, and all necessary legal documents for returning home. The entire document processing cycle takes about 1 to 3 months.
The surrogacy process in Kyrgyzstan in 2026 is already very mature. Legitimate agencies provide full-service one-stop management, saving unmarried individuals the hassle of cross-border coordination.
